Clearfield Pride Festival this Weekend

CLEARFIELD - The inaugural One Community Pride Festival kicks off in Clearfield this weekend. Held on Saturday June 7th at the Clearfield County Fairgrounds this event will provide a safe space for anyone to celebrate pride. Tri-County Weekly Gas Price Update 

UNDATED - Gas Prices continue to fall in our area. According to AAA, Jefferson County sits at the lowest average once again at $3.24 dollars per gallon, down six cents from last week. Clearfield County went down three cents to $3.36 dollars. Elk County is still at... Read More.
